Nua, a digital-first, omni-channel women’s wellness brand, has raised USD 50 million in a Series C round led by Peak XV and Filter Capital, with participation from existing investors Mirabilis Investment Trust and Footpath Ventures. The round includes a primary raise and secondaries offering partial exits to Kae Capital, Lightbox VC and existing angel investors.
The capital will support brand building, expand reach and distribution, and strengthening R&D to build an innovation pipeline across women’s wellness. Founded in 2017, Nua serves over 3 million women and girls every month across period care, maternity care and intimate care, and has recently launched digital offerings including the Nua Period Tracker App and SecretKeeper chat.
“We have scaled our annualised revenue run rate from Rs 100 crore to Rs 500 crore in just 24 months, while remaining profitable,” said Ravi Ramachandran, Founder & CEO, Nua.
“Nua has emerged as the fastest-growing brand in the category and the second-largest player online, demonstrating its ability to compete and win alongside much larger incumbents,” said Sakshi Chopra, Managing Director, Peak XV.
